Section 50.90 - Layoff Appeals
Current through Register Vol. 48, No. 52, December 27, 2024
a)
b) An investigation shall be conducted by the Commission and the proposed findings shall be served upon all parties to the dispute. The parties shall then have 21 calendar days to file in the office of the Commission a response to the proposed findings and a request for hearing if either party so desires.
c) If in the judgement of the Commission a material issue of fact or law exists, the parties will be notified of a date of hearing. The notice will set forth a short statement of the issue of fact and/or law. If the Commission determines that no material issue of fact or law exists, it will issue its decision based upon the findings of the investigation and the parties' responses thereto.
